
Course Objective

This course in an introduction to creating large and complex finite element assemblies using the Batch Modeling technology in the 3DEXPERIENCE Platform. The course also discusses managing the product structure for large assemblies of parts and meshes created either in the 3DEXPERIENCE Platform or in 3rd-party tools.
The course covers the following topics:
- External Simulation Representations
- Batch Modeling
The course is divided into lectures, demonstrations and workshops. The course's workshops are integral to the training. They are designed to reinforce concepts presented during the lectures and demonstrations. They are intended to provide users with the experience of running and trouble-shooting actual Abaqus analyses.
